Aberdeen Asset Management completes acquisition of Artio Global Investors
Aberdeen Asset Management announced Wednesday that it has completed the acquisition of Artio Global Investors, a US publicly listed asset manager.

The group paid $179.7m (£118.3m) for the acquisition, which is expected to be earnings enhancing from the outset.
The share price rose 0.12% to 482.90p by 08:30.
